Macedonia - Tobacco Yield
Since 2015, Macedonia Tobacco Yield jumped by 0.7% year on year. At 1.55 Metric Tons Per Hectare in 2020, the country was ranked number 11 comparing other countries in Tobacco Yield. Macedonia is overtaken by Greece, which was ranked number 10 at 1.58 Metric Tons Per Hectare and is followed by Serbia at 1.46 Metric Tons Per Hectare. Spain ranked the highest with 3.25 Metric Tons Per Hectare in 2020, that is a growth of 1.6% compared to 2019. Turkey recorded the best 5 years average growth at +3.9% per year, while Serbia was the worst growing country at -5.2% per year.
